Media: Spain’s Ceuta prepares for possible new migrant surge VIDEO

10 August 2026 17:40

Spain’s autonomous city of Ceuta is facing the threat of another influx of migrants from Morocco, prompting the Defence Ministry to cancel all leave for military personnel stationed there, EFE reports.

The president of the Spanish Troops and Seamen Association (ATME), Marco Antonio Gómez, told EFE that the order requires all military personnel currently on leave, whether in Spain or abroad, to return to their units.

He added that “exceptional cases” will be decided at the discretion of the respective unit commander.

The situation in the city has yet to return to normal, 10 days after a mass influx of migrants, and continues to raise concern among Spanish authorities.

Some of those who entered Ceuta from Morocco remain living on the city’s beaches, with many lacking necessities.

Between 1,300 and 4,000 unaccompanied minors may still be in the city.

At the end of July, tens of thousands of migrants reached the autonomous city by swimming or on foot, bypassing the breakwater separating Ceuta from Morocco.

According to the Spanish government, around 72,000 migrants entered Ceuta, of whom approximately 70,000 have already returned to Morocco.
